STATEMENT OF WORK: Provide labor and material to groom, lubricate, test and inspection and issue certification for the Comforts COI and ABS classification on the 10 passenger and cargo elevators listed below. Contractor shall coordinate testing with the local ABS Surveyor and the USCG marine inspection office. This groom shall also apply to elevators supporting equipment to include but not limited to motor controllers, cables etc.   Elevator TypeCapacityLocationModelManufacturer PERS CAP 1250LBS03-96-2 1157-4-1* CARGO7500LBS3-38-11444-1* CARGO7500LB3-38-11444-1* CARGO7500LB3-38-11444-1* CARGO7500LB5-44-31443-1* CARGO7500LB5-44-31443-1* CARGO7500LB5-44-31443-1* CARGO7500LB5-70-21445-1* CARGO7500LB5-72-31445-1* CARGO7500LB5-72-11445-2* * UNIDYNAMICS/SAINT LOUIS INC b. Provide a condition found report to the port engineer and chief engineer. Note any parts required to correct the problem in this report. Any additional work and parts will be covered by change orders. c. Perform a weight test in the presents of the ABS and/or USCG Inspector. (d) Comptroller General Examination of Record. The Contractor shall comply with the provisions of this paragraph (d) if this contract was awarded using other than sealed bid, is in excess of the simplified acquisition threshold, and does not contain the clause at 52.215-2, Audit and Records--Negotiation. (1) The Comptroller General of the United States, or an authorized representative of the Comptroller General, shall have access to and right to examine any of the Contractor's directly pertinent records involving transactions related to this contract. (2) The Contractor shall make available at its offices at all reasonable times the records, materials, and other evidence for examination, audit, or reproduction, until 3 years after final payment under this contract or for any shorter period specified in FAR Subpart 4.7, Contractor Records Retention, of the other clauses of this contract. If this contract is completely or partially terminated, the records relating to the work terminated shall be made available for 3 years after any resulting final termination settlement. Records relating to appeals under the disputes clause or to litigation or the settlement of claims arising under or relating to this contract shall be made available until such appeals, litigation, or claims are finally resolved. (3) As used in this clause, records include books, documents, accounting procedures and practices, and other data, regardless of type and regardless of form. This does not require the Contractor to create or maintain any record that the Contractor does not maintain in the ordinary course of business or pursuant to a provision of law.
